Picture a medium-sized cold room built to hold frozen food at -22°C. The compressor unit and condenser sit outdoors, but the equipment that actually controls the temperature inside the room is the industrial air cooler mounted near the ceiling. It is the component operators see every day, and it is the part most likely to undermine performance if it is undersized or mismatched with the rest of the refrigeration unit.
An industrial air cooler, also called a cold blower or unit cooler in cold storage practice, is the heat-absorption end of a complete refrigeration unit. It does not produce cold by itself. It removes heat from the room air and transfers that heat to refrigerant flowing through its coil. The refrigerant then carries the heat to the condenser, where it is released outside.
Position the air cooler in a vapor-compression cycle and the picture becomes clear. The compressor, condenser, expansion valve, and evaporator are the four core components of any refrigeration system, and in an industrial cold storage system the evaporator is the air cooler. Liquid refrigerant enters the finned tubes through the expansion valve. As it evaporates, it absorbs heat from the air that fans push across the finned surface, and the chilled air recirculates through the room.
Keep two levels of terminology separate. A refrigeration unit, or refrigeration system, is the complete engineered loop: the compressor unit, condenser, expansion valve, air cooler, and the piping and controls that connect them. An industrial air cooler is one component inside that loop. Sizing an air cooler without checking the compressor unit and condenser is a common source of short cycling, excessive defrost, and wasted energy.

Wholesale Aircooler Cold Blower Suppliers, Factory - Zhejiang Lanxi RefrigeratioZhejiang Lanxi Refrigeration Equipment Co., Ltd is China wholesale Aircooler Cold Blower suppliers and factory,The Aircooler Cold Blower ...View Product →Three terms are often mixed up in industrial refrigeration discussions: industrial air cooler, air conditioner, and air-cooled condenser. They describe completely different pieces of equipment, and confusing them leads to incorrect specifications.
An industrial air cooler is an evaporator installed inside the space to be cooled, absorbing heat from the room air. An air-cooled condenser sits at the opposite end of the loop: it is the heat-rejection component installed outdoors or in a machine room, releasing absorbed heat to the surrounding air. The two cannot replace each other, because a condenser does not cool the room and an air cooler does not reject heat to the environment. An air conditioner is a complete packaged system with its own compressor, condenser, expansion valve, and evaporator, designed primarily for human comfort rather than process or storage duty.
| Equipment | Role in the cycle | Typical location | Primary function |
|---|---|---|---|
| Industrial air cooler | Evaporator (heat absorption) | Inside the cold room | Removes heat from room air and transfers it to the refrigerant |
| Air-cooled condenser | Condenser (heat rejection) | Outdoors or in a machine room | Releases absorbed heat to the outside air |
| Air conditioner | Complete packaged cooling unit | Indoor and outdoor sections | Provides comfort cooling with its own compressor, condenser, and evaporator |
Operating conditions set them apart even further. A cold storage air cooler may run at evaporating temperatures from roughly -35°C to -5°C, handling frost buildup, high moisture loads from frequent door openings, and continuous duty in food, pharmaceutical, or chemical environments. Comfort air conditioners are not built for those conditions, which is why they have no place in a serious cold storage design.
Air cooler selection starts with two questions: what temperature must the room hold, and how should air be distributed through the space? Both answers lead to a specific series and a specific airflow configuration.
Manufacturers commonly structure air cooler lines around temperature bands, and the DD, DL, and DJ series labels are the most widespread convention. DD series air coolers for high-temperature cold storage serve chilled rooms around 0°C to 5°C, where thin frost and light duty allow a compact coil. DL series cold blowers for medium-temperature applications fit rooms down to roughly -18°C and need a deeper coil and a more capable defrost system. DJ series cold blowers for low-temperature freezers are built for deep-freeze rooms at -25°C and below, with wide fin spacing, stronger fans, and heavy-duty defrost.

As room temperature drops, evaporating temperature drops with it. A cooler that performs well in a +5°C chilled room will frost up quickly and lose capacity in a -25°C freezer, so the temperature range is the first filter in every selection.
Nominal capacity alone does not guarantee an even room temperature. The cooler must distribute air across the entire storage volume, and the airflow pattern has to match the room shape and stacking pattern.
Ceiling-mounted dual-side discharge air coolers throw air in two opposite directions, which suits long, narrow cold rooms and high-bay freezers. The air sweeps the full length of the space and reduces temperature stratification between floor and ceiling.
Where headroom is limited, or where racks and dense product loading block overhead airflow, floor-mounted outlet air coolers are a practical alternative. They deliver air horizontally at low level, are easier to reach for maintenance and defrost drainage, and work well when ceiling height is too low for an effective ceiling-mounted throw. The trade-off is floor space, so their position must be planned around forklift traffic and loading operations.
When you issue an inquiry, use a specification checklist rather than a vague request. These parameters determine whether the cooler will hold the room temperature and run efficiently.
Fin spacing and defrost deserve extra attention in low-temperature rooms. Frost accumulates continuously on the coil. If the spacing is too tight, airflow decays quickly and the cooler enters defrost too often, pushing the room temperature up and down and stressing the compressor. The right design depends on the load profile, door-opening pattern, and available defrost energy source.
Once the air cooler parameters are fixed, move to the rest of the loop. The condenser must reject the room load plus the compressor heat, so review the air-cooled condenser series before finalizing the compressor and piping arrangement.
A refrigeration unit works as one team. The air cooler absorbs heat from the room, the compressor unit raises refrigerant pressure and temperature, the condenser rejects the heat outside, and the expansion valve meters refrigerant back into the cooler. Every component must operate within the same evaporating and condensing envelope.
The most frequent mismatch found in the field is an air cooler specified for one temperature range and a compressor unit specified for another. Compressors have defined application limits. If the evaporating temperature falls outside that range, capacity drops, oil return becomes unreliable, and the compressor runs hot. Always cross-check the design evaporating temperature of the air cooler against the application range of the compressor unit.
For plants where water is available and heat loads are high, an evaporative condenser can be considered instead of an air-cooled condenser. It typically rejects heat at a lower condensing temperature, improving system efficiency, but it adds water treatment and maintenance requirements. The choice affects total operating cost and must be coordinated with the compressor unit and air cooler capacity.
Piston compressor units are common for small and medium cold rooms. They are simple, responsive, and available in parallel configurations that stage capacity to match partial loads by starting and stopping individual compressors, which saves energy below full load. For larger plants that run close to full load for long periods, screw compressor units provide better part-load efficiency in the medium-to-high capacity range and longer service intervals. On a large low-temperature store, the design commonly centers on screw compressor refrigeration units configured with internationally recognized compressors.

The compressor determines how long the system runs before major maintenance and how efficiently it turns electricity into cooling. International brands such as Bitzer, Frascold, Fusheng, Hanbell, Refcomp, and RFC are widely used in industrial refrigeration and have established service networks. The industrial air cooler is the part of the refrigeration unit that products actually feel. It must match the room temperature, the airflow pattern, the frost load, and the compressor unit that drives the whole loop.
The selection path works best in order. Define the temperature band, choose the airflow configuration, specify heat exchange capacity and defrost method, then match the cooler to a compressor unit and condenser from the same system design.
